When Atlassian started bringing Rovo into Trello, I had one question: could it actually make one of my boards better?
So I pointed it at a real board that’s been sitting unfinished in my own workspace—my meal planning board—and let it tell me what was working and what wasn’t.
Some of the suggestions were surprisingly good. Others… not so much.
In this video, you’ll see exactly how Rovo analyzes an existing Trello board, what kinds of recommendations it makes, where it falls short today, and why I’m still excited about where this feature could be headed.
If you’ve been curious about AI in Trello but aren’t sure whether it’s actually useful yet, this should give you a realistic look at what to expect.
